Transaction 03af84d96c50d3c57497a9e31c14b637ab0024c86b55aeed4ef02e8aba170355
1 Input
1 Output
-
03af84d96c50d3c57497a9e31c14b637ab0024c86b55aeed4ef02e8aba170355:0
- value
- 15850
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d51b6ed53e2ad384f9acc9897b6b2721fc86f2e1c7a49965e42f29255f58933c
- address
- tb1p65dka4f79tfcf7dvexyhk6e8y87gduhpc7jfje0y9u5j2h6cjv7q5c3wdv